The Australian Plant Name Index (APNI) is a tool for the botanical community that deals with plant names and their usage in the scientific literature, whether as a current name or synonym. APNI does not recommend any particular taxonomy or nomenclature. Comment:Bentham attributes this name to "F. Muell. Fragm. vi. [sic] 68" [i.e. F.J.H. von Mueller, Fragm. 7(53): 68 (1870)]. While Mueller indicates that Caesia acanthoclada may be better placed in Corynotheca, the genus name was not validly published at the time and Mueller did not definitely associate it with the species epithet (ICN Art. 35 (Shenzhen Code, 2018)).
